Tolls- be careful when driving through toll booth, yes it is in your agreement, but a few weeks after rental I had an additional charge for tolls. I brought the EZ pass from my own car, thinking that would be fine, but still got an $11 charge for convenience of their toll by plate number service. Paid the $1 on my transponder, and the Hertz plate toll fees. Chose Hertz over competitors bc it was the cheapest option for the large car I wanted. When factoring in insurance and toll charges, no longer the cheaper option. I will stick to my regular local rental company.
